About CLVT Clarivate Plc

Clarivate is a data, information, and software workflow solutions company serving customers primarily in academia, government, law, life sciences, and healthcare. The company was formerly part of Thomson Reuters before being sold to private equity as an independent company in 2016. In 2019, Clarivate went public on the New York Stock Exchange. Around half of the company's revenue is generated in the Americas, while Europe, Middle East, and Africa account for around a quarter.

About BSTZ BlackRock Science and Technology Term Trust of Beneficial Interest

BlackRock Science and Technology Trust II is a non-diversified, closed-end management investment company. The trust's investment objectives are to provide total return and income through a combination of current income, current gains, and long-term capital appreciation. Its portfolio consists of Equity Securities, Options, Preferred Securities, Convertible Securities, Depositary Receipts, Non-U.S. Securities, Emerging Markets Investments, Restricted and Illiquid Investments, Private Company Investments, Corporate Bonds, and other investments. The trust seeks to Invest at least 80% of its total assets in equity securities issued by U.S. and non-U.S. science and technology companies in any market capitalization range from the development, advancement, and use of science and/or technology.
